Architecture And Data Flow

The DDE architecture routes events through ingestion buffers, transformation services, and durable storage. Incoming telemetry is normalized, enriched, and distributed to downstream engines that handle alert evaluation, reporting, and user interfaces.

Services communicate over mutually authenticated channels, with strict versioning for APIs and event formats. Each processing stage can scale independently, and backpressure mechanisms prevent overload while preserving ordering guarantees where necessary.

Deployment And Environment Management

Organizations use DDE across dev, staging, and production environments, with promotion pipelines that enforce policy checks before changes advance. Environment profiles define resource quotas, network routes, and access policies that match compliance needs.

Infrastructure as code practices, combined with automated drift detection, ensure that environment definitions remain consistent. Teams can replicate blueprints across regions while preserving isolation and observability.

Observability And Incident Response

Built in dashboards, traces, and log correlations give operators a unified view of system health. SLOs, error budgets, and runbooks guide response actions, and owners can quickly determine the blast radius of any incident.

Incident timelines are recorded with context, including deployment events, configuration changes, and external dependencies. This structured history supports post incident reviews and continuous improvement of operational practices.

Operational Best Practices And Recommendations

  • Define clear ownership for each service and alert rule to avoid gaps during incidents.
  • Use version controlled environment definitions and automated policy checks for all changes.
  • Schedule regular review of retention settings, compliance tags, and access permissions.
  • Run incident postmortems that update runbooks and observability dashboards for future events.
  • Leverage workflow automation for routine tasks, freeing teams to focus on higher value work.
